背景 jwilder/dockerize: Utility to simplify running applications in docker containers ufoscout/docker-compose-wait: A simple script to wait for other docker images to be started while using docker-compose この辺は全部試したが, PHP から接続しようとすると Connection Refused が多発する。TCP で接続可能になってから実際に利用可能になるまで若干のラグがあるため,もっと確実な方法を探していた。 対処法 sh -c 'docker-compose logs -f <MySQLコンテナ名> | { sed "/\[Entrypoint\]: MySQL init proces